Output e34cef6e018613ee8521a76c121bc743a48319c5d21c70b4bf51cc249d06e206:1

value
19175458
script pubkey
OP_0 OP_PUSHBYTES_20 9bb8c2b534aed1d6ef673683ca8afdcac70cee7f
address
bc1qnwuv9df54mgadmm8x6pu4zhaetrsemnlakdp7a
transaction
e34cef6e018613ee8521a76c121bc743a48319c5d21c70b4bf51cc249d06e206
spent
true